01:06All right. The Hollywood Walk of Fame recognizes achievements in the categories of motion picture, radio, live theater, live performance, sports, entertainment, recording and television.
01:19Today, in the category of television, we honor Mindy Kaling with star number, count them, two thousand eight hundred on the Hollywood Walk of Fame.
01:34Now, before we invite Mindy to the stage, let me tell you a little bit about our honoree.
01:41She does just about everything. She is an Emmy nominated writer, a Tony Award winning producer and New York Times bestselling author, director and actor.
01:54She's been named one of the brightest voices of her generation.
01:59In twenty twenty three, the White House honored Mindy with the National Medal of Arts, the highest civilian honor given to artists by the US government.
02:09Last February, she received the Producers Guild of America's prestigious Norman Lear Achievement Award in television.
02:19Sorry, that was a period award in television. In twenty twenty two, Kaling International was named one of Time's one hundred most influential companies.
02:34In twenty twelve, Mindy was named one of Time Magazine's one hundred most influential people in the world.

02:51At age twenty four, Mindy joined the eight person writing staff of NBC's The Office.
02:57During her eight seasons at the show, she wrote twenty three episodes.
03:03In parens, it says far more than any other writer for that show.

03:21She was nominated for an Emmy, which was the first of many firsts for Mindy Kaling, the first woman of color to be nominated for an Emmy in any writing category.
03:40Mindy is the creator, star, and executive producer of The Mindy Project.
03:48I wonder where you got that title from, The Mindy Project, for which she wrote twenty four of the one hundred and seventeen episodes, produced over six seasons.
03:58In twenty twenty, Mindy released the critically acclaimed series Never Have I Ever for Netflix.
04:08Season one reached forty million homes in its first four weeks of release, with the fourth and final season premiering last year to critical acclaim.
04:19Mindy is also the co-creator and executive producer of the Warner Brothers television comedy The Sex Lives of College Girls.
04:33Which had the biggest premiere of any comedy on HBO Max in twenty twenty one.
04:39Following its success, that show was renewed for a second and third season.
04:45In twenty twenty four, Mindy produced the Oscar nominated short film Anuja.
04:55A powerful story that follows two sisters on a journey to find joy and opportunity in a world intent on their exploitation and exclusion.
05:06Additionally, Mindy co-created and is executive producer of the new Netflix WBTV comedy Running Point.
05:21Starring Kate Hudson, scheduled for release in about ten days, on February twenty seventh.

05:40Mindy has published two best selling New York Times books, comedic memoirs.
05:47One is, Is Everyone Hanging Out Without Me? and Other Concerns.
05:52And the second is, Why Not Me?
05:55In addition to a collection of essays titled, Nothing Like I Imagined.
06:01Most recently, Mindy launched her imprint, Mindy's Book Studio, for Amazon Publishing.
06:07With the mission of publishing titles from new and emerging diverse voices.
